Lab21 buys Delphic Diagnostics
Healthcare diagnostics company Lab21 has acquired Delphic Diagnostics from its administrators BDO. The terms of the deal were not disclosed.
Delphic Diagnostics provides drug monitoring and laboratory services to the pharmaceutical industry, and has particular expertise in HIV and hepatitis. The company has laboratories in Liverpool and in Kent.
Maddy Kennedy, CFO of Lab21, said: '[The] purchase of the Delphic business and assets is expected to contribute substantial sales in 2010 and to be accretive to Lab21's earnings from early next year. It also adds significant management and clinical expertise to [the business].'
The deal comes after Cambridge-based Lab21 acquired diagnostic companies Plasmatec Laboratory Products and Biotec Laboratories earlier in the year.
